I love when a Susan Tedeschi or Janis Joplin style singer gets involved with the blues. You can really see how the music effects their soul and see what they are putting into it as well. I thought this album was pretty good. She has some of her own tunes, as well as some covers like "Remedy" and "Humble Pie", which are decent covers. Not too bad overall, i enjoyed tracks 1, 5, and 9 the most.
